thumb|Torpo Church and Torpo Stave Church Torpo is a small village in Ål municipality, in Buskerud County, Norway, and can be reached by using highway 7.
The name Torpo was adopted July 1, 1935 from the old name Torpe. At this date the train station and local post office started using the new adopted name.
